SUMMARY

The discussion focuses on calculating the amount of air required to inflate a spherical balloon from a radius of r inches to r + 1 inches. The volume of a sphere is given by the formula V(r) = (4/3)πr³. To find the air needed for inflation, the correct approach is to calculate the difference in volume between the two radii, resulting in A(r) = V(r + 1) - V(r) = (4/3)π[(r + 1)³ - r³]. This method ensures an accurate representation of the air volume increase.

Hi guys, can you help me out with a homework question. I'm stuck and don't know what to do. Question state:

A spherical balloon with radius r inches has volume V(r) = (4/3)r3. Find a function that represents the amount of air A required to inflate the balloon from a radius of r inches to a radius of r + 1 inches.


Don't I just replace (r) with (r+1).. ?


The Attempt at a Solution



A(r)= (4/3)pi(r+1)^3 ??

Thanks a lot.
 
Physics news on Phys.org
That would be the amount of air required to inflate a balloon of radius r+1. You want a *difference*.
 
ahh got it :) thank you genneth...
